1. Read all instructions and important safeguards.

2. Remove all packaging materials and make sure items are received in good

condition.

3. Tear up all plastic bags as they can pose a risk to children.

4. Wash lid, steam vent and accessories in warm, soapy water. Rinse and dry

thoroughly.

5. Remove inner pot from rice cooker and clean with warm, soapy water. Rinse

and dry thoroughly before returning to cooker.

6. Wipe body clean with a damp cloth.

• Do not use abrasive cleaners or scouring pads.

• Do not immerse the rice cooker base, cord or plug in water at any time.

USING YOUR RICE COOKER

Before First Use:

To Cook Rice:

1. Using the measuring cup provided, measure out the desired amount of rice.

One full, level cup of uncooked rice will yield 2 cups of cooked rice. The

measuring cup provided adheres to rice industry standards (180mL) and is not

equal to one U.S. cup (240 mL).

2. Rinse rice in a separate container until the water becomes relatively clear;

drain.

3. Place rinsed rice in the inner pot.

4. Using the measuring cup provided or the water measurement lines located

inside the inner pot, add the appropriate amount of water. If you are making

brown rice, follow the rice/water measuring guide for brown rice located on

page 9 of this manual. Do not use the water measurement lines inside the inner

pot for brown rice, they are intended for white rice only.

5. For softer rice, allow rice to soak for 10-20 minutes prior to cooking.

6. Making sure that the exterior of the inner pot is clean, dry and free of debris; set

the inner pot in the rice cooker. Snap the lid closed and plug the power cord

into a wall outlet.

* To avoid loss of steam and longer cooking times, do not open the lid at

any point during the cooking process.

7. To begin cooking, press the "WHITE RICE" or "BROWN RICE" button, depending

on the type of rice to be cooked. The cooking mode indicator light will

illuminate. Once cooking is complete, the rice cooker will automatically switch

to keep warm mode.

8. After cooking, open the lid and use the rice paddle to stir the rice. This will release

excess moisture and give the rice a fluffier texture. Then, close the lid and allow

the unit to remain on warm mode for 5-10 minutes. This will ensure optimal rice

texture and moisture level.

9. Press the "WARM/OFF" button to turn off the rice cooker. If the “WARM/OFF”

button is not pressed, the rice cooker will remain in keep warm mode. It is not

recommended to leave rice on keep warm mode for more than 12 hours.
